Polina Specktor, MD
Neurologist
Better dementia care begins with knowledge. Strengthening education and public awareness can lead to earlier recognition, prevention, and care.
Current Work
Polina is Head of the Cognitive Clinic at Carmel Medical Center in Israel. Her work combines clinical care for dementia and cognitive impairment, community education, and research, with a focus on improving brain health, early diagnosis, and equitable access to cognitive care.

Strategy
Polina studies ethnic disparities in dementia diagnosis and care to raise awareness among healthcare professionals and policymakers. She is also developing community-based early detection initiatives to improve dementia outcomes and reduce health inequities.
Impact
As an Atlantic Fellow, Polina aims to expand her research, build international collaborations, and develop scalable community-based approaches to dementia education and early detection for diverse populations in Israel and beyond.
Motivation
In Israel, access to specialized cognitive care remains limited, particularly for underserved populations. Polina seeks to address these gaps by improving dementia awareness, early detection, and equitable access to cognitive care.
Education & Experience
Dr. Polina Specktor completed her Neurology residency and Cognitive Neurology fellowship at Rambam Medical Center, Israel. She is Head of the Cognitive Clinic at Carmel Medical Center and a Lecturer at the Technion Faculty of Medicine. Her work focuses on dementia care, brain health promotion, and reducing disparities in dementia diagnosis and care.
